Why Choose a Local Queenstown Arborist?
Queenstown’s distinct climate, with its frosty winters and often dry, hot summers, along with specific soil conditions and common tree species, demands a nuanced approach to tree care. A local arborist understands these environmental factors implicitly. They know which trees thrive here, which are prone to disease or pest infestations, and the best practices for their health and longevity in a Queenstown setting. This local expertise is invaluable for ensuring your trees are not just managed, but genuinely cared for.
Beyond environmental understanding, a local Queenstown arborist is familiar with regional council regulations and best practices regarding tree removal, pruning, and protection. This ensures all work is compliant and carried out responsibly. They can also offer timely service, which is particularly important during storm seasons or when dealing with immediate hazards, providing peace of mind that help is close at hand.
Common Tree Services in Queenstown
Queenstown homeowners often require a range of tree services tailored to their specific properties and the local landscape. Tree pruning and trimming are frequently requested to maintain tree health, encourage growth, and ensure branches don't pose a risk to homes or power lines. Given the scenic value of properties here, aesthetic shaping is also a common need.
Tree removal is another significant service, especially for trees that are diseased, storm-damaged, or are interfering with structural integrity or construction plans. Stump grinding and removal are typically performed afterwards, clearing the way for new landscaping or construction. For new builds or landscape renovations, tree planting and consultation services help choose species suited to Queenstown's environment and a property's specific conditions. Emergency tree services are vital after high winds or heavy snow, addressing fallen branches or precarious trees promptly and safely.
Tree-Related Challenges for Queenstown Homeowners
Queenstown's climate and terrain present unique challenges for homeowners concerning their trees. Heavy winter snow and strong winds can cause significant damage, leading to broken branches or even fallen trees, posing a risk to property and safety. This necessitates proactive pruning and swift response from arborists.
Rapid urban development means existing trees on properties might conflict with new building plans or infrastructure. Homeowners often face decisions about preserving valuable specimens versus the practicalities of construction. Root systems can also be a concern, potentially impacting foundations, driveways, or underground services if not managed correctly. Proper tree selection and placement, along with regular maintenance, are key to mitigating these common issues.

When is the best time to prune trees in Queenstown?
General pruning for health and structure is often best done in late winter or early spring before new growth begins. However, this can vary significantly depending on the tree species and the purpose of the pruning. Professional arborists can advise on the optimal timing for your specific trees in Queenstown’s climate.
Do I need council permission to remove a tree in Queenstown?
It depends on the tree and its location. The Queenstown Lakes District Council has specific rules and regulations regarding tree removal, particularly for protected trees, those within certain zones (e.g., urban protection areas), or those above a certain size. It's always best to check with the QLDC or consult with a local arborist who is familiar with these regulations before proceeding with any tree removal.
What should I do if a tree on my Queenstown property is damaged by a storm?
Safety is paramount. If a tree or large branch has fallen or is unstable, immediately secure the area from people and pets. Do not attempt to clear large debris or unstable branches yourself, especially if they are near power lines.
